Postby Felix/FFDS » Fri Aug 31, 2007 8:41 pm

THe SDKs themselves are a collection of documents, etc. that are not stand alone by themselves.

for that matter, you also need to download and install the SDK SP1a update from the fsinisider.com/donwloads site.

Bascially, once you set up gmax and the FS-X gamepack, your problems THE FUN, starts.

That's where you learn to model, following the guidance of the SDKs, and export to FS-X...
